Fisker and solid-state LiDAR partner Quanergy to showcase Fisker EMotion at CES in January

Green Car Congress

Fisker Inc. Quanergy System will be integrating five of Quanergy’s S3 solid-state LiDAR sensors ( earlier post ) into the Fisker EMotion. Fisker and Quanergy Systems, are working closely in partnership to integrate autonomous hardware—specifically LiDAR—in the Fisker EMotion body design as a seamless part of the vehicle.

Quantum to provide plug-in hybrid control software to relaunching Fisker

Green Car Congress

has entered into an agreement with Fisker Automotive and Technologies Group LLC pursuant to which Quantum will license its plug-in hybrid control software to Fisker Auto Group and, in return, will receive an initial payment of $2.0 million of software development services to be provided to Fisker Auto Group over the next twelve months.

Fisker Becomes Karma Automotive, To Relaunch In 2016

Green Car Reports

Henrik Fisker hasn't been involved with his namesake company since before it declared bankruptcy in 2013. But Fisker Automotive has continued to bear his name since being purchased by Chinese automotive supplier Wanxiang.

A123 Systems Signs Multi-Year Li-ion Battery System Supply Agreement With Fisker Automotive, Intends to Invest Up To $23M in Fisker

Green Car Congress

A123 Systems has entered a battery supply agreement with Fisker Automotive to supply battery systems for the Fisker Karma Plug-in Hybrid Electric Vehicle (PHEV). New Fisker Targets Mid-2016 For U.S. Production Of Luxury Plug-In Hybrid

Green Car Reports

Production of the Fisker Karma plug-in hybrid will resume next year, according to a new report. The "new Fisker" is making preparations to restart production in California, a major milestone in its comeback from bankruptcy.
